Standard Identifier: 6.EE.9

Grade: 6
Domain: Expressions and Equations

Cluster:
Represent and analyze quantitative relationships between dependent and independent variables.

Standard:
Use variables to represent two quantities in a real-world problem that change in relationship to one another; write an equation to express one quantity, thought of as the dependent variable, in terms of the other quantity, thought of as the independent variable. Analyze the relationship between the dependent and independent variables using graphs and tables, and relate these to the equation. For example, in a problem involving motion at constant speed, list and graph ordered pairs of distances and times, and write the equation d = 65t to represent the relationship between distance and time.

Standard Identifier: 6.RP.1

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Understand the concept of a ratio and use ratio language to describe a ratio relationship between two quantities. For example, “The ratio of wings to beaks in the bird house at the zoo was 2:1, because for every 2 wings there was 1 beak.” “For every vote candidate A received, candidate C received nearly three votes.”

Standard Identifier: 6.RP.2

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Understand the concept of a unit rate a/b associated with a ratio a:b with b ≠ 0, and use rate language in the context of a ratio relationship. For example, “This recipe has a ratio of 3 cups of flour to 4 cups of sugar, so there is 3/4 cup of flour for each cup of sugar.” “We paid $75 for 15 hamburgers, which is a rate of $5 per hamburger.”

Footnote:
Expectations for unit rates in this grade are limited to non-complex fractions.

Standard Identifier: 6.RP.3.a

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Use ratio and rate reasoning to solve real-world and mathematical problems, e.g., by reasoning about tables of equivalent ratios, tape diagrams, double number line diagrams, or equations. Make tables of equivalent ratios relating quantities with whole number measurements, find missing values in the tables, and plot the pairs of values on the coordinate plane. Use tables to compare ratios.

Standard Identifier: 6.RP.3.b

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Use ratio and rate reasoning to solve real-world and mathematical problems, e.g., by reasoning about tables of equivalent ratios, tape diagrams, double number line diagrams, or equations. Solve unit rate problems including those involving unit pricing and constant speed. For example, if it took 7 hours to mow 4 lawns, then at that rate, how many lawns could be mowed in 35 hours? At what rate were lawns being mowed?

Standard Identifier: 6.RP.3.c

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Use ratio and rate reasoning to solve real-world and mathematical problems, e.g., by reasoning about tables of equivalent ratios, tape diagrams, double number line diagrams, or equations. Find a percent of a quantity as a rate per 100 (e.g., 30% of a quantity means 30/100 times the quantity); solve problems involving finding the whole, given a part and the percent.

Standard Identifier: 6.RP.3.d

Grade: 6
Domain: Ratios and Proportional Relationships

Cluster:
Understand ratio concepts and use ratio reasoning to solve problems.

Standard:
Use ratio and rate reasoning to solve real-world and mathematical problems, e.g., by reasoning about tables of equivalent ratios, tape diagrams, double number line diagrams, or equations. Use ratio reasoning to convert measurement units; manipulate and transform units appropriately when multiplying or dividing quantities.

Standard Identifier: 7.EE.1

Grade: 7
Domain: Expressions and Equations

Cluster:
Use properties of operations to generate equivalent expressions.

Standard:
Apply properties of operations as strategies to add, subtract, factor, and expand linear expressions with rational coefficients.

Standard Identifier: 7.EE.2

Grade: 7
Domain: Expressions and Equations

Cluster:
Use properties of operations to generate equivalent expressions.

Standard:
Understand that rewriting an expression in different forms in a problem context can shed light on the problem and how the quantities in it are related. For example, a + 0.05a = 1.05a means that “increase by 5%” is the same as “multiply by 1.05.”

Standard Identifier: 7.EE.3

Grade: 7
Domain: Expressions and Equations

Cluster:
Solve real-life and mathematical problems using numerical and algebraic expressions and equations.

Standard:
Solve multi-step real-life and mathematical problems posed with positive and negative rational numbers in any form (whole numbers, fractions, and decimals), using tools strategically. Apply properties of operations to calculate with numbers in any form; convert between forms as appropriate; and assess the reasonableness of answers using mental computation and estimation strategies. For example: If a woman making $25 an hour gets a 10% raise, she will make an additional 1/10 of her salary an hour, or $2.50, for a new salary of $27.50. If you want to place a towel bar 9 3/4 inches long in the center of a door that is 27 1/2 inches wide, you will need to place the bar about 9 inches from each edge; this estimate can be used as a check on the exact computation.
